Career path
| Career Role (Diagnostic Radiology) | Description |
|---|---|
| Diagnostic Radiographer | Acquire and analyze medical images (X-ray, CT, MRI, ultrasound) to assist physicians in diagnosis and treatment planning. High demand role in UK healthcare. |
| Radiology Specialist Registrar | Advanced training position for doctors specializing in diagnostic radiology. Requires significant medical experience and further radiology training. |
| Medical Imaging Technician (Radiography) | Operates imaging equipment, prepares patients, and ensures the high quality of medical images. Essential support role within Diagnostic Radiology departments. |
| Radiology Informatics Specialist | Manages and analyzes large datasets of medical images. Growing field integrating advanced technologies in image processing and data analysis. |
| Radiology Consultant | Senior physician specializing in diagnostic radiology, offering expert interpretations and guidance. Highly specialized role at the peak of a radiology career. |
